One of the most iconic of the natural wonders of the Wild Coast is Hole in the Wall in Coffee Bay. Living up to its name, this is a massive hole carved by the waves in a free-standing mountain (or island) in the water. Only shorter travel trailers recommended.The Hole-in-the-Wall country was made famous by a conglomeration of bandits in the mid 1800’s. This is not an actual hole in the wall or cave, but rather, a splendid red, sandstone escarpment at the southern side of the Big Horn Mountains. In the heart of the Mojave National Preserve, Hole-in-the-Wall Campground provides visitors a true desert camping experience. Each of the 35 sites is located on an open desert plain surrounded by nearby peaks that change color with each rising and setting sun. The campground feels exposed to all the elements: sun, wind, rain and snow. Temperatures soar during the day and plummet at night ... They can be contacted via phone at for pricing, directions, reservations and more.There are two options when it comes to camping near Rialto Beach. The first option is to car camp at the Mora Campground, which is 3 miles away from the beach. You can pull up with your car at a campsite and pitch a tent. You can find out more about the Olympic National Park campgrounds here.
